Transaction 4e72d78b9176a7525859635e6660f406671a3be4af85dff89cfd4ccf9e99247d

3 Input
2 Outputs
  • 4e72d78b9176a7525859635e6660f406671a3be4af85dff89cfd4ccf9e99247d:0
  • value  174644
    address  124Wp16ZHxDhaXDmfshZmZ8H4Fyc5hJTMY
  • 4e72d78b9176a7525859635e6660f406671a3be4af85dff89cfd4ccf9e99247d:1
  • value  13915021
    address  1JUijZ9LFR8oQCmcpsVSxiLUmLAdNmKeCh